Presta and Schrader holes are different sizes so you'd have to drill.

Depending on what kind of riding you do rocket rons are good XC and light trail tires, then nobby nics being another step up the trail ladder. Snakeskin sidewalls are recommended if you're doing tubeless.

RR rear and NN front is a decent combo for most things. (I had a F series bike with that combo)

Big vote for Conti Mountain Kings here. Broad range of price options, as well as widths.

Far stickier rubber than a majority of the tires out there, particularly the cheapos. Hard rubber is great if you ride rock all day long, but for mixed riding, with dirt, roots, and rocks, softer gives much better grip for control during braking, cornering, etc. Yes, softer rubber wears out faster, but nothing worse than a 5 year old, barely worn down, hard compound tire that has just rounded off the edges of the knobs, less than no bite, but to look at them, you'd think, why would I replace it, the knob are still so big?
